Reigning champions of Varsity cup basketball to contest for the title once again.
The Wits basketball teams have been selected to participate in the 2019 Varsity Basketball tournament taking place in October this year.
The teams qualified for the tournament after finishing in the top eight male teams and top four women’s teams of the University Sports South Africa (USSA) rankings.
The men’s head coach, Tshiamo Ngakane, said that his team won the inaugural tournament against UCT last year and they intend to win again this year, but admitted that it is going to be a lot tougher.
“Other teams have really upped their performance and have closed the gaps on us,” Ngakane told Wits Vuvuzela.
According to the coach, the University of Johannesburg (UJ) team poses a significant threat to Wits. “That’s a very good team and we have had some epic battles this year in various leagues and tournaments that we have both been involved in,” he added.
Women’s teams will be introduced into the tournament this year. Chairperson of Wits basketball and women’s Lady Bucks player Nametso Mahlako believes this move is a positive move.
“It shows that as basketball we are progressing and we hope that this will increase opportunities for women in basketball,” Mahlako told Wits Vuvuzela.
“We also hope that it will inspire confidence in and increase the number of women who want to participate in basketball on a competitive level,” she added.
Ngakane added that there is depth in the squad so supporters can expect a great fight from the Wits side. “We have had good performances generally but are probably short because of our own expectations,” he told Wits Vuvuzela.
The tournament takes place at the Wits Multi-Sports Hall on the first two weekends in October.
